Starting your PhD journey at Micalis

To begin your PhD at the Micalis Institute, we offer several pathways after you complete your Master 2:

  • Competing for a ministerial scholarship
  • Team funding opportunities through various calls for projects, encompassing national, international, departmental, and regional sources.
  • CIFRE funding, which promotes collaboration between academia and industry, providing a unique pathway to a PhD.
